Have you ever wondered what makes caviar so special? If you’ve seen it in fine dining restaurants or on fancy menus, you might have asked yourself: what exactly is it, and why is it so expensive?

The Answer Is: These Are Sturgeon Eggs—Caviar!

Caviar is the luxurious, high-end delicacy made from the eggs (or roe) of the sturgeon, a type of ancient fish. It’s considered one of the world’s most sought-after foods, revered for its exquisite taste, rich texture, and refined flavor. But caviar isn’t just prized for its taste—there’s a lot more to it than meets the eye.

Why Is Caviar So Expensive?
Caviar’s price tag can be jaw-dropping, with some varieties costing hundreds, or even thousands, of dollars per pound. But why is it so expensive? Here are a few reasons:

  • The Harvesting Process: Sturgeon don’t reach reproductive maturity until they are several years old, which means harvesting their eggs is a slow, delicate process. Only a small amount of roe is harvested at a time, and the sturgeon must be treated with care to ensure they are not harmed during this process.
  • Rarity of Sturgeon: Sturgeon populations are declining due to overfishing and habitat destruction, making them harder to find and regulate. This makes caviar even rarer, further driving up the price.
  • Labor-Intensive Production: High-quality caviar requires meticulous processing. After harvesting, the roe must be carefully cleaned, salted, and packaged to maintain its delicate texture and flavor. Only the finest eggs—those that are firm, glossy, and uniformly sized—make the cut.

The Nutritional Power of Caviar
It’s not just the luxury factor that makes caviar stand out. These tiny, glossy eggs are packed with nutrients that can benefit your health. Caviar is rich in:

  • Protein: Essential for building and repairing tissues.
  • Omega-3 Fatty Acids: Important for heart and brain health.
  • Vitamins: High in vitamins A, B12, and D, caviar helps promote a healthy immune system and supports bone health.

How Is Caviar Typically Served?
Caviar is often enjoyed as a garnish or eaten on its own. It’s traditionally served chilled on ice, accompanied by blinis (small pancakes), toast points, or crackers. It’s also commonly paired with a dollop of crème fraîche. The delicate flavor and texture of caviar are best enjoyed when you take small, careful bites to savor its unique taste.
